Treehugger Robot
fe9ad25625
Merge "Filter REL out of PLATFORM_VERSION_ALL_CODENAMES." into main am: 624b0f4b2f
am: 175dd937e4
...
Original change: https://android-review.googlesource.com/c/platform/build/+/2773148
Change-Id: Ibfaa73d81fa4b296728c7e979b351751126911d9
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2023-10-05 01:15:53 +00:00
Treehugger Robot
175dd937e4
Merge "Filter REL out of PLATFORM_VERSION_ALL_CODENAMES." into main am: 624b0f4b2f
...
Original change: https://android-review.googlesource.com/c/platform/build/+/2773148
Change-Id: Ifbffd104bfb476c7eb8af3aa2eeefae8a103309b
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2023-10-05 00:41:48 +00:00
Dan Albert
5346f7db62
Filter REL out of PLATFORM_VERSION_ALL_CODENAMES.
...
The codename of the current release is replaced by "REL" when the
build is configured as a release rather than a preview. For example,
PLATFORM_VERSION_CODENAME.UpsideDownCake will be "REL" rather than
UpsideDownCake in a -next target when the upcoming release is
UpsideDownCake. "REL" shouldn't really be treated as a codename
though. It's a placeholder to indicate that the build is a release and
so doesn't really have a codename. The list of all codenames ends up
in ro.build.version.all_codenames, and also ends up feeding the logic
for stub generation in soong, neither of which are places that should
include REL.
Bug: http://b/303087088
Test: m ndk # with barbet-next-userdebug in goog/main
Change-Id: I97972439e1f06c09f0ed59e7e2191c489a214e88
2023-10-04 23:11:39 +00:00
Treehugger Robot
efc6bdd970
Merge "Use deterministic salt for boot image avb footer" into main am: 2b181f9aa1
am: 006c13c27b
...
Original change: https://android-review.googlesource.com/c/platform/build/+/2768202
Change-Id: I821633c3ce6b918c9b5129a9a419c1e71e3e415f
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2023-10-04 18:18:06 +00:00
Treehugger Robot
006c13c27b
Merge "Use deterministic salt for boot image avb footer" into main am: 2b181f9aa1
...
Original change: https://android-review.googlesource.com/c/platform/build/+/2768202
Change-Id: I834cfd2b29a2eb66f2f339108bfe9c511e6038f8
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2023-10-04 17:47:15 +00:00
Treehugger Robot
2b181f9aa1
Merge "Use deterministic salt for boot image avb footer" into main
2023-10-04 17:08:25 +00:00
Justin Yun
f1942a76cc
Merge "Remove PRODUCT_PRODUCT_VNDK_VERSION from soong_config" into main am: f81405aab0
am: a1822c5b6b
...
Original change: https://android-review.googlesource.com/c/platform/build/+/2763508
Change-Id: I61c4a4fd70733d8f2239fd350d8d52b952a94d1a
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2023-10-04 07:37:44 +00:00
Justin Yun
a1822c5b6b
Merge "Remove PRODUCT_PRODUCT_VNDK_VERSION from soong_config" into main am: f81405aab0
...
Original change: https://android-review.googlesource.com/c/platform/build/+/2763508
Change-Id: Ic94faf3c5dda0f552424fa638e8f3f33c5c2d8d8
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2023-10-04 07:08:01 +00:00
Justin Yun
f81405aab0
Merge "Remove PRODUCT_PRODUCT_VNDK_VERSION from soong_config" into main
2023-10-04 06:29:31 +00:00
Treehugger Robot
a4ce1535e6
Merge "Allow installing fake vendor packages" into main am: 7683671bcd
am: f676520f42
...
Original change: https://android-review.googlesource.com/c/platform/build/+/2768203
Change-Id: Iee7e65d8f67bb73f309ebaf4dbde450796a9f519
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2023-10-03 23:33:59 +00:00
Treehugger Robot
f676520f42
Merge "Allow installing fake vendor packages" into main am: 7683671bcd
...
Original change: https://android-review.googlesource.com/c/platform/build/+/2768203
Change-Id: I84f6eba29780fd637ec77c255cc3e8c702ee555a
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2023-10-03 23:04:26 +00:00
Treehugger Robot
7683671bcd
Merge "Allow installing fake vendor packages" into main
2023-10-03 22:40:30 +00:00
Cole Faust
976a52c007
Allow installing fake vendor packages
...
This line in base_rules.mk requires a variable that's qualified by
target/host, the partition, and the module class. There didn't exist
one for target/vendor/fake, so fake vendor modules failed to compile.
Add a TARGET_OUT_FAKE so we can use fake vendor modules. This is aimed
at using install_symlink on the vendor partition.
https://cs.android.com/android/platform/superproject/main/+/main:build/make/core/base_rules.mk;l=279;drc=c67e769b8c44eeb9bb851f20003b63d35193e155
Bug: 205632228
Test: presubmits
Change-Id: If4618f90cebbafcd44e88e38513033282c37c1b7
2023-10-03 14:27:35 -07:00
Kelvin Zhang
de53f7df43
Use deterministic salt for boot image avb footer
...
avbtool by default generates a random salt everytime, this makes builds
less reproducible. Use sha256 checksum of kernel image as the hex to
make the build reproducible.
Test: th
Bug: 293313353
Change-Id: I959b3dee77654098ab9fde475f11eaee8d40c790
2023-10-03 12:26:08 -07:00
Jihoon Kang
3e3b687dcd
Merge "Revert^2 "Add soong config variable Release_expose_flagged_api"" into main am: a65cdd5024
am: 078aa1a5ee
...
Original change: https://android-review.googlesource.com/c/platform/build/+/2768376
Change-Id: I6a101aba8f3351381b73cc7046d292985b436157
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2023-10-03 18:32:50 +00:00
Jihoon Kang
078aa1a5ee
Merge "Revert^2 "Add soong config variable Release_expose_flagged_api"" into main am: a65cdd5024
...
Original change: https://android-review.googlesource.com/c/platform/build/+/2768376
Change-Id: I606e80325d05f52132acf1d940f362649817e141
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2023-10-03 18:02:14 +00:00
Jihoon Kang
a65cdd5024
Merge "Revert^2 "Add soong config variable Release_expose_flagged_api"" into main
2023-10-03 17:55:17 +00:00
Jihoon Kang
00328e40be
Revert^2 "Add soong config variable Release_expose_flagged_api"
...
This reverts commit 453d74ba48
.
Change-Id: Ic5cc83ebe396ccf05b51b8306b79a61dbb689807
2023-10-03 01:02:07 +00:00
Treehugger Robot
4ed24d84ed
Merge "Delete staging directory after creating module package zip" into main am: 517308b890
am: 5a5685a6a9
...
Original change: https://android-review.googlesource.com/c/platform/build/+/2767637
Change-Id: I619efebd9c2181489b358d2036fee2dbef939021
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2023-09-30 03:09:48 +00:00
Treehugger Robot
5a5685a6a9
Merge "Delete staging directory after creating module package zip" into main am: 517308b890
...
Original change: https://android-review.googlesource.com/c/platform/build/+/2767637
Change-Id: I560705e092b2ee8d0e0a5b5ed6786b9aa307dff8
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2023-09-30 02:02:18 +00:00
Colin Cross
585967c08a
Delete staging directory after creating module package zip
...
The staging directory isn't used after the module packaging zip is
built. Delete the staging directory to reduce disk usage without
affecting incremental build performance.
Bug: 302573555
Change-Id: I377c60714f78760d0b6c2588935c12e10a9ed224
Test: treehugger
2023-09-30 00:37:38 +00:00
Cole Faust
2dcd7616e6
Merge "Revert^3 "Make the target_files zip reflect the recent partition change"" into main am: 985332eaca
am: 1c1740fab4
...
Original change: https://android-review.googlesource.com/c/platform/build/+/2768628
Change-Id: I88c09eef0e9c19d5c98b3c5ad251efc384a57ffb
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2023-09-29 19:48:48 +00:00
Cole Faust
1c1740fab4
Merge "Revert^3 "Make the target_files zip reflect the recent partition change"" into main am: 985332eaca
...
Original change: https://android-review.googlesource.com/c/platform/build/+/2768628
Change-Id: I739819707a9a5de49224ebd9bcf9b9d7bdc3a838
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2023-09-29 18:41:28 +00:00
Cole Faust
985332eaca
Merge "Revert^3 "Make the target_files zip reflect the recent partition change"" into main
2023-09-29 18:09:39 +00:00
Xin Li
c04229bbea
Merge "Merge UP1A.231005.007" into aosp-main-future
2023-09-29 06:40:54 +00:00
Cole Faust
c517d2faf7
Merge "Remove other partition's AVB properties" into main am: 06223362d7
am: dce3a9d66c
...
Original change: https://android-review.googlesource.com/c/platform/build/+/2768106
Change-Id: I2000ed49ecf8a97054e4ed6c8425d8f5f6177633
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2023-09-29 00:54:17 +00:00
Cole Faust
83fe17e0a4
Revert^3 "Make the target_files zip reflect the recent partition change"
...
This reverts commit cb63de55b7
.
Reason for revert: Still more broken devices
Change-Id: Ic55ba78dd9c2e34dc96549ac8aba65fdbefd379b
2023-09-29 00:22:27 +00:00
Cole Faust
dce3a9d66c
Merge "Remove other partition's AVB properties" into main am: 06223362d7
...
Original change: https://android-review.googlesource.com/c/platform/build/+/2768106
Change-Id: I027f479e7cb807eec39a09dd23c5f37107246c4e
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2023-09-28 23:48:44 +00:00
Cole Faust
13d374ab41
Remove other partition's AVB properties
...
This is to ensure a partition doesn't need to be aware of the other
partitions in order to be built.
Also sort the image info file so it's easier to compare with bazel.
Bug: 297269187
Test: m && emulator on sdk_phone_x86_64-userdebug
Change-Id: I8e4b2049f602c8db109bf53e1359751a9ed9dd7a
2023-09-28 12:04:56 -07:00
Cole Faust
8e6660f733
Merge "Add extra variables to soong.variables" into main am: b78b334041
am: 2b24df300d
...
Original change: https://android-review.googlesource.com/c/platform/build/+/2765709
Change-Id: I53ddc0c3d6ed256a4673a4fea2aeaa35bf40c33d
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2023-09-28 18:28:22 +00:00
Cole Faust
2b24df300d
Merge "Add extra variables to soong.variables" into main am: b78b334041
...
Original change: https://android-review.googlesource.com/c/platform/build/+/2765709
Change-Id: I51944fa8d61be1f2ba4a3ab3732ad77d9103245f
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2023-09-28 17:23:44 +00:00
Cole Faust
b78b334041
Merge "Add extra variables to soong.variables" into main
2023-09-28 16:38:28 +00:00
Maxim Siniavine
80956a4660
Merge "Revert "Add soong config variable Release_expose_flagged_api"" into main am: 377cf62987
am: 2af9c2423d
...
Original change: https://android-review.googlesource.com/c/platform/build/+/2766349
Change-Id: I3637c727b5d4ce10881310df311520461293040d
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2023-09-28 03:02:10 +00:00
Maxim Siniavine
2af9c2423d
Merge "Revert "Add soong config variable Release_expose_flagged_api"" into main am: 377cf62987
...
Original change: https://android-review.googlesource.com/c/platform/build/+/2766349
Change-Id: Ia1f46a2112240fc26a90a223e903f16bf6ce3ae6
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2023-09-28 01:55:21 +00:00
Maxim Siniavine
377cf62987
Merge "Revert "Add soong config variable Release_expose_flagged_api"" into main
2023-09-28 01:08:44 +00:00
Maxim Siniavine
453d74ba48
Revert "Add soong config variable Release_expose_flagged_api"
...
Revert submission 2755310
Reason for revert: Broken build b/302407753
Reverted changes: /q/submissionid:2755310
Change-Id: If2b09e6609cdd4c47eea12cb2d877c3874e0560b
2023-09-28 01:02:02 +00:00
Xin Li
5cca3caa48
Merge UP1A.231005.007
...
Bug: 291102124
Merged-In: Ib9596152fe20b412bf7f5e90a19b55f3c0f5523f
Change-Id: I4a0d6dfe3a5b4642f5c4cdf257c84c1634888699
2023-09-27 16:08:15 -07:00
Cole Faust
c874c70f45
Add extra variables to soong.variables
...
Also always use BUILD_NUMBER_FROM_FILE in the BUILD_FINGERPRINT.
The build number file now always exists, even if HAS_BUILD_NUMBER is
false.
Bug: 297269187
Test: m bazel_sandwich
Change-Id: Idf745b600b167e5cec161e07139be09a037bdc13
2023-09-27 13:44:56 -07:00
Rajeev Kumar
1125fdf90c
Merge "Add devicelock to the list of individually toggleable module." into main am: d7965bd12c
am: 77b936b764
...
Original change: https://android-review.googlesource.com/c/platform/build/+/2763932
Change-Id: I9d44d9d28a6b29766c499836bdb382e502b54da4
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2023-09-27 19:50:28 +00:00
Jihoon Kang
7ca3a3b2ea
Merge "Add soong config variable Release_expose_flagged_api" into main am: 19cd806de1
am: 3163daa603
...
Original change: https://android-review.googlesource.com/c/platform/build/+/2763272
Change-Id: Ib8380984c004bd2847c3eed24b20e6bb1f09c846
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2023-09-27 19:47:53 +00:00
Rajeev Kumar
77b936b764
Merge "Add devicelock to the list of individually toggleable module." into main am: d7965bd12c
...
Original change: https://android-review.googlesource.com/c/platform/build/+/2763932
Change-Id: If8e176fbff2d58c3b94f9a09fb57b18446fc36d2
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2023-09-27 19:45:19 +00:00
Rajeev Kumar
d7965bd12c
Merge "Add devicelock to the list of individually toggleable module." into main
2023-09-27 19:06:11 +00:00
Jihoon Kang
3163daa603
Merge "Add soong config variable Release_expose_flagged_api" into main am: 19cd806de1
...
Original change: https://android-review.googlesource.com/c/platform/build/+/2763272
Change-Id: I1054493df1c337790d479531cb8d103ac917577f
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2023-09-27 17:52:34 +00:00
Justin Yun
cd7c0300b5
Remove PRODUCT_PRODUCT_VNDK_VERSION from soong_config
...
We can remove PRODUCT_PRODUCT_VNDK_VERSION safely as soong does not
read it.
Bug: 302255959
Test: m
Change-Id: I1d4080b8e6f8b04c0c1333bcd9bf055d329fdd71
2023-09-27 16:38:13 +09:00
Rajeev Kumar
e71b6333c4
Add devicelock to the list of individually toggleable module.
...
Bug: 300099037
Test: Builds successfully
Change-Id: I4231021982819cf227f3f1298c376635e160ab72
2023-09-26 20:16:57 -07:00
Treehugger Robot
6311f5a3a5
Merge "Remove architecture name from names of HOST_*.mk files." into main am: 1741facdbf
am: cd4c262258
...
Original change: https://android-review.googlesource.com/c/platform/build/+/2694564
Change-Id: I7102a14dca424d2f0cb3f4113765db3bed3bf101
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2023-09-26 23:34:02 +00:00
Treehugger Robot
cd4c262258
Merge "Remove architecture name from names of HOST_*.mk files." into main am: 1741facdbf
...
Original change: https://android-review.googlesource.com/c/platform/build/+/2694564
Change-Id: I588d140258ed188b1393aa4fa5180629a8b74358
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2023-09-26 22:38:01 +00:00
Jihoon Kang
ccebab160e
Add soong config variable Release_expose_flagged_api
...
The variable is a release config variable which will be used to
determine whether if the api marked @FlaggedApi is exposed or not.
Test: m nothing
Bug: 299570421
Change-Id: Iad902b5ceb2e6d6e9f8fc3b81d54ce3d1896f9eb
2023-09-26 22:32:37 +00:00
Treehugger Robot
1741facdbf
Merge "Remove architecture name from names of HOST_*.mk files." into main
2023-09-26 21:15:42 +00:00
Jihoon Kang
5d2cf49036
Merge "Add PRODUCT_NEXT_RELEASE_HID_FLAGGED_API for sdk targets" into main am: 596d514744
am: 452241468c
...
Original change: https://android-review.googlesource.com/c/platform/build/+/2756249
Change-Id: Ifd9cac6afb96aae06489e881ce8e14dc3b7ec414
Signed-off-by: Automer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com >
2023-09-26 19:19:18 +00:00